Jeff Vinik Reshapes Tampa Bay Lightning Ownership Structure

Jeff Vinik, the prominent owner of the Tampa Bay Lightning, is in the process of reshaping the team's ownership structure in a significant yet strategic manner. Vinik, who purchased the Lightning in 2010 for a reported $170 million, is now gearing up to sell a majority stake in the organization. This move, however, does not imply that he will completely cede control of the franchise.

A Strategic Transition with Continuity

Reports suggest that Jeff Vinik plans to retain a substantial portion of ownership. This strategic decision ensures that there will be no change in the day-to-day operations of the Lightning and Vinik Sports Group, the entity that oversees the team. In an official announcement, Vinik confirmed, "I can confirm that we are in discussions to further expand our ownership group of the Tampa Bay Lightning. There will be no change in the day-to-day operations of the Lightning and Vinik Sports Group. I am very excited about what is to come for the organization, and we look forward to sharing more when the time is right."

Under Vinik’s stewardship, the Lightning have achieved remarkable success, winning back-to-back Stanley Cup championships in 2020 and 2021. He has been lauded for his commitment to ensuring the team's competitiveness and for fostering a positive culture within the franchise.

A Historic Valuation

The prospective buyer, believed to be Doug Ostrover, co-founder and CEO of Blue Owl Capital, would be acquiring a team now valued at nearly $2 billion. This valuation, if the sale goes through, would mark the largest in NHL history, surpassing the previous record set by Michael Andlauer’s purchase of the Ottawa Senators for $950 million in September.
